    3. > I am looking for a Thomas Risinger in the 1900 census of Utica and am wondering what enumeration district might have included the address: 112 Miller?? > > Anyone have a guess? > > Many Thanks, Janet Currie *********************************************** 1910 Census Risinger, Thomas F. Age: 67 Gender: M Race: W Birthplace: PA State: New York County: ONEIDA Locale: 15-WD UTICA Series: T624 Roll: 1053 Part: 1 Page: 293A Risinger, William Age: 27 Gender: M Race: W Birthplace: PA State: New York County: ONEIDA Locale: 15-WD UTICA Series: T624 Roll: 1053 Part: 1 Page: 293A *Note: the census page is very hard to read at genealogy.com. **************************************************** 1900 Census Oneida: District 86 Utica, N. Y., Fifteenth Ward.; Bounded by South St., Miller St., Pleasant St., Steuben St., District 87 Utica, N. Y., Fifteenth Ward.; Bounded by South St., Neilson St., Pleasant St., Miller St. Looking at the 1900 Ed section at ancestry, I'd try these two ED's under other other townships first . He did not show up in the 1900 index. Not a perfect index. Good luck. margy
